Keeping Your Garlic Butter Beef Rollups Fresh

So, you've got leftovers of your amazing Garlic Butter Beef Rollups? Lucky you! Store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. I've made the mistake of just wrapping them in foil, and they dried out so fast. Don't do that! When reheating, I like to pop them in a skillet over low heat with a splash of water, covered, to keep them from getting tough. Or, a quick zap in the microwave works too, but they might lose a little of their crispy edge. They're still super tasty the next day, though, sometimes even better as the flavors meld!

FAQs About Garlic Butter Beef Rollups

Can I use different ground meat for these Garlic Butter Beef Rollups?

Yep, you sure can! I've experimented with ground turkey and chicken before. Just know that leaner meats might need a bit more oil or butter in the pan to stay juicy. The flavor will be a little different, but still super tasty with that amazing garlic butter.

What's the best way to prevent the rollups from falling apart?

The trick is making sure your patties aren't too thick and your cheese is really melted and gooey. That melted cheese acts like a delicious glue! Also, don't overstuff with toppings. A gentle, firm roll usually does the trick. Practice makes perfect, hon!

Can I make the beef mixture 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can mix the ground beef with all the seasonings a day in advance. Just cover it tightly and keep it in the fridge. This actually helps the flavors meld even more, making your Garlic Butter Beef Rollups even more delicious when you cook them up.

What if I don't have fresh parsley for the garlic butter?

No worries at all! While fresh parsley adds a lovely color and brightness, you can totally skip it if you don't have any on hand. The garlic butter will still be incredibly flavorful. You could also use a tiny pinch of dried parsley, but honestly, fresh is best if you can swing it.

Are these Garlic Butter Beef Rollups good for meal prep?

They totally are! You can cook the cheesy beef patties and store them separately from your toppings and garlic butter. Then, just reheat the patties and assemble when you're ready to eat. It makes for a super quick and satisfying lunch or dinner during the week. So convenient!

Ingredients

Hearty Beef & Cheese Core

  • 1 lb 80/20 ground beef
  • 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Aromatic Garlic Butter

  • 4 tbsp unsalted butter
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ped

Crisp Wraps & Tangy Toppings

  • 8 large butter lettuce leaves
  • 1/2 cup dill pickle slices, chopped
  • 1/4 cup red onion, finely diced
  • 2 tbsp sugar-free ketchup
  • 1 tbsp yellow mustard

Instructions

  1. 1
    Prep Beef Mixture
    Combine 1 lb 80/20 ground beef, 1 tsp onion powder, 1/2 tsp smoked paprika, 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ce, 1/2 tsp salt, and 1/4 tsp black pepper in a bowl. Mix gently until just combined. This forms the flavorful core for your Easy Garlic Butter Beef Cheeseburger Rollups.
  2. 2
    Form & Cook Patties
    Divide the beef mixture into 8 equal portions and flatten into thin patties, about 3-4 inches wide.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ook patties for 3-4 minutes per side, or until browned and cooked through.
  3. 3
    Melt Cheese on Patties
    Once patties are cooked, reduce heat to low. Top each patty with about 2 tbsp of 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ese. Cover the skillet for 1-2 minutes, allowing the cheese to melt perfectly over the patties for your Easy Garlic Butter Beef Cheeseburger Rollups.
  4. 4
    Make Garlic Butter
    While cheese melts, in a small microwave-safe bowl, melt 4 tbsp unsalted butter. Stir in 3 cloves garlic, minced, and 2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ped. This aromatic garlic butter will elevate the flavor profile of your rollups.
  5. 5
    Prepare Fresh Toppings
    In a small bowl, combine 2 tbsp sugar-free ketchup and 1 tbsp yellow mustard for a classic burger sauce. Arrange 8 large butter lettuce leaves, 1/2 cup dill pickle slices, chopped, and 1/4 cup red onion, finely diced, for easy assembly.
  6. 6
    Assemble Cheeseburger Rollups
    Lay out a butter lettuce leaf. Place a cheesy beef patty in the center. Drizzle generously with the garlic butter, then top with chopped dill pickles, diced red onion, and a dollop of the ketchup-mustard sauce. Roll up tightly to complete your individual Easy Garlic Butter Beef Cheeseburger Rollups.
  7. 7
    Serve & Enjoy
    Repeat with remaining ingredients to create all your Easy Garlic Butter Beef Cheeseburger Rollups. Serve immediately and savor this delicious, low-carb take on a classic cheeseburger.

Notes

1

For juicier patties, avoid overmixing the ground beef. Gentle handling keeps the texture tender and prevents tough burgers.

2

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Keep the beef patties separate from the lettuce and toppings to prevent sogginess.

3

Feel free to customize your rollups! Try different cheeses like provolone or pepper jack, or add extra toppings like bacon bits or sliced avocado.
